Prince Harry's return to Britain has reignited debate about whether taxpayers should foot the bill to protect him and his family, with experts warning genuine threats likely exist. "It's very surprising," Scott Hamer, an ex-protection officer for Harry's father King Charles III when he was Prince of Wales, told AFP. "There's probably people who are being protected now who are at less threat and risk than he is.
